  • Polymerizable composition, optical material comprising the composition and method for producing the material
    申请人:——
    公开号:US20040254258A1
    公开(公告)日:2004-12-16
    A cured matter obtained by polymerizing and curing a polymerizable composition comprising a compound having at least one episulfide in a molecule is reduced in an odor by adding a perfume to the polymerizable composition comprising the compound having at least one episulfide in a molecule. A cloudiness of the lens is removed by raising a purity of sulfur to 98% or more. A reduction in a chlorine content of the sulfur compound described above to 0.1% by weight or less elevates an oxidation resistance and a light fastness of the high refractive index optical material and improves a color tone thereof. An optical product having a high refractive index and a high-degree transparency is provided by subjecting the composition in advance to deaerating treatment at 0 to 100° C. for one minute to 24 hours under a reduced pressure of 0.001 to 50 torr.
    通过聚合和固化至少含有一种环硫醚的化合物的可聚合组合物获得的治愈物质,通过向至少含有一种环硫醚的化合物的可聚合组合物中添加香水来减少其气味。通过将硫的纯度提高到98%或更高,可以消除镜片的混浊。将上述硫化合物的氯含量降低至0.1%或更低可以提高高折射率光学材料的氧化抗性和耐光性,并改善其色调。通过在0至100°C下将组合物事先进行脱气处理,以在0.001至50 torr的减压下持续1分钟至24小时,可提供具有高折射率和高度透明度的光学产品。
  • Thermal insulating foamed material and method for manufacturing the same
    申请人:MATSUSHITA ELECTRIC INDUSTRIAL CO., LTD.
    公开号:EP0700953A2
    公开(公告)日:1996-03-13
    A polyurethane foam is constituted by using a blowing agent selected from the group consisting of iodofluorohydrocarbons, perfluoroalkenes and hydrogen-containing fluoromorpholine derivatives. These blowing agents have a low thermal conductivity and a short life in the air, and thus impose no or very small load such as ozone layer depletion potential (ODP) and global warming potential (GWP) on the environment. The iodofluorohydrocarbon, in particular, can give an incombustibility and self-extinguishing property to the conventionally used inflammable substance such as cyclopentane or the like, and thus is also advantageous from the viewpoint of safety of the thermal insulating material.
    聚氨酯泡沫塑料是由一种发泡剂构成的,该发泡剂选自碘氟烃类、全氟烯类和含氢氟吗啉衍生物。这些发泡剂导热系数低,在空气中的寿命短,因此不会或仅会对环境造成很小的负荷,如臭氧层破坏潜能值(ODP)和全球变暖潜能值(GWP)。尤其是碘氟烃,可以使传统使用的环戊烷等易燃物质具有不燃性和自熄性,因此从隔热材料的安全性角度来看也是有利的。
